COMMUNITY EVENTS
Pingelly Volunteer Fire and Rescue Service is committed to helping the community. Before the heat of Summer sets in, the Pingelly Volunteer Fire and Rescue Service in conjunction with the Shire of Pingelly carries out hazard reduction burns within the town area. The burns are a sure method of reducing areas of heavy weed growth and contribute to the overall safety of the community. The Pingelly Volunteer Fire and Rescue Service has been engaged in hazard reduction burns since the early 1960's.
The Pingelly Volunteer Fire and Rescue Service is also involved in the Anzac Day March as well as Guarding the Eternal Flame. Members guard the Eternal Flame from 6.00pm on the 24th April until 6.00pm 25th April, Anzac Day. Members also participate in the Dawn Service.
Two events that the Pingelly Volunteer Fire and Rescue Service is proud to deliver to the Pingelly community are the Christmas Day Santa Run and the Easter Bunny Run. Both these events are well received by the Pingelly community and members are happy to board the Big Red Fire truck and deliver happiness to the local young and not so young!
